Hope you can help

I've been unemployed for nearly a year through a horrible fear of work. I keep making excuses for not applying for jobs and two years ago i managed to go through a interview and was offered a second interview which i ended up turning down as i was so scared. I really regret that and think about it all the time.
I think it has started from my school days,leaving without qualifications where my friends we're all going to uni.
I'm terrified of answering the phone at work,which i have no idea where that has come from.
It just seems to get worse and friends and employers all think i don't want to work. But i just can't stop the fear.
I'd really appreciate some advice,thankyou.

Hi Jane

I myself didnt work for a long time because of panic and felt i didnt have the confidence to hold down a job. I had a few different jobs but i had to leave because of panic, i thought i would never be able to work again.
But i knew deep down it wasnt helping me been at home all the time so i decided to get some voluntary work at my local day care centre for the elderly. While i was working volunatry i never had any panic i think its because i could just do as i pleased and didnt have any set hours and also i didnt have any pressure or routine. Doing this really helped me build my confidence as i hadnt worked for such a long time. I now work part-time although its not with the elderly i work in a office now.
Maybe you could try some voluntary work to help with your confidence.
